3 OUR ACTIVITIES IN THE USA TOTAL & THE UNITED STATES OF AMERICA MORE THAN SIXTY YEARS OF HISTORY Our story in the United States began in 1956 with the creation of American Petrofina in Texas. In the years since then, Total in the USA has grown from a refining and marketing presence to a fully-integrated oil and gas company with activities across the entire energy value chain. 4 OUR ACTIVITIES IN THE USA EXPLORE AND PRODUCE EXPANDING OUR FOOTPRINT IN OFFSHORE AND ONSHORE OIL AND GAS FIELDS Active in Exploration and Production (E&P) in the United States since 1957, Total has a diverse portfolio of operated and non-operated oil and gas assets, from deep-offshore projects to onshore shale gas developments. In the Gulf of Mexico, our focus is on the deepwater domain, with working interests in two producing fields: Tahiti (17%), operated by Chevron, and Chinook (33.33%), operated by Petrobras. Following the closing of the acquisition of Maersk Oil*, Total will become a partner (25%) in the Chevron operated Jack field. We also hold a working interest in the North Platte discovery, operated by Cobalt International Energy, and in the Anchor discovery (12.5%), operated by Chevron. In January 2018, we announced a major oil discovery in the deep offshore Ballymore prospect. Our acquisition of a working interest in Ballymore (40%) was part of an exploration agreement with Chevron, signed in September 2017, covering seven prospects. Natural Gas and Natural Gas Liquids Trading and Marketing Total in the USA was able to capitalize on the Group's worldwide experience in LNG to develop a portfolio of U.S. LNG export contracts. The recent agreement to acquire Engie's LNG assets* - including interests in the Cameron LNG liquefaction project in Louisiana - will help us ramp up our activity to account for more than 10% of the global U.S. LNG exports by By then, Total will be exporting LNG out of three liquefaction plants on the Gulf of Mexico. With a strong track record of trading on the U.S. energy markets (natural gas, natural gas liquids, power, dry products), Total markets its own shale gas production and offers services such as production marketing, midstream optimization, financial trading and risk management. A world leader in batteries With Saft, acquired in 2017, Total develops solutions for energy storage, a critical issue for the expansion of renewable energies. Saft - which has a manufacturing facility in Jacksonville, Florida - has supplied the space industry for over 50 years. With over 400 batteries in orbit, Saft has the largest fleet of batteries in space, equating to more than 35,000 cells with 620 million hours in operation. 6 OUR ACTIVITIES IN THE USA TRANSFORM AND DEVELOP STRENGTHENING OUR PRESENCE IN REFINING AND CHEMICALS From crude oils to gasoline and high-end plastic components, Total adds value along the whole U.S. petrochemical chain of production, investing to meet the country s growing demand for petrochemicals products. In the Port Arthur industrial complex in Texas, we refine up to 200,000 barrels per day. The plant can process heavy crude oil as well as lighter domestic crudes. It also has a dedicated unit to produce low-sulfur fuels, which reduce greenhouse gas emissions. We also own a steam cracker in a jointventure with BASF that can transform a wide range of feedstocks such as ethane, propane, butane and naphtha into ethylene, propylene, butadiene and other chemical raw materials. In March 2017, we unveiled a $1.7-billion investment project with Borealis and Nova to build a cracker that will start production in Petrochemicals are the linchpin of our U.S. business. Total operates one of the world s largest polypropylene plants in La Porte, Texas, which produces thermoplastic polymers used in applications ranging from packaging and textiles to lab equipment and automotive parts. We also own the world s largest styrene and polystyrene facility in Carville, Louisiana, and a polyethylene plant in Bayport, Texas, that makes plastic for containers including bottles. Our Cray Valley affiliate develops and produces additives for tires, automobile belts, sealants, paints and golf balls. Smart solutions for demanding markets Hutchinson, a Total affiliate, manufactures customized solutions for the automotive and aerospace industries such as thermal and acoustics insulation systems for planes and trains. 7 OUR ACTIVITIES IN THE USA SHIP AND MARKET DELIVERING HIGH-PERFORMANCE LUBRICANTS FOR ALL MARKET APPLICATIONS With operations in Special Fluids, Aviation Fuels and Lubricants, Total continues to establish its market presence by providing solutions tailored to serving customers' needs. Total's specialty fluids and solvents Total s high purity special fluids, manufactured at the Bayport facility, are used by industries across the USA ranging from oil & gas and paints & coatings to the aerospace and agricultural markets. As a major player in the US jet fuel market, Total services airports and airlines by pipeline and road across the country. Innovative lubricants sets us apart from competitors. In the United States, we manufacture, market and distribute high-performance lubricants for the automotive, heavy duty, food, metalworking, energy and manufacturing industries. We operate an ISO-Certified blending plant in Linden, New Jersey. SCALING UP IN REFINING & CHEMICALS Our American refining and chemicals activities are centered on the U.S. Gulf Coast, where we own the 200,000 barrel/day Port Arthur Refinery. The refinery is integrated with a 40% owned 1 MT/yr ethylene steam cracker. plant in Bayport (both in Texas). In Carville, Louisiana, we run the world s largest polystyrene plant, part of the world s biggest styrene facility. Other U.S. chemical activities include Cray Valley (hydrocarbon resins) and Novogy (bio-based products). Hutchinson (specialty chemicals) is present in Brazil, Mexico, Canada and the United States.
